Nonlinear optimization 如何将范数平方方程转换成凹形?

Nonlinear optimization 如何将范数平方方程转换成凹形?,nonlinear-optimization,quadratic-programming,cvx,non-convex,Nonlinear Optimization,Quadratic Programming,Cvx,Non Convex,所以目标函数类似于| hxθxg |^2,其中h是nx1复数行向量,θ是nxn复数矩阵,g是nx1列向量 如果我想最大化这个,在cvx中,最大化凸函数是不允许的 如何将其转换为凹面等效形式?这通常是不可能的。有时一阶条件(或KKT条件,如果有约束)会导致更容易解决的问题。@ErwinKalvelagen I实际上使用了一阶近似来解决它。

所以目标函数类似于| hxθxg |^2,其中h是nx1复数行向量,θ是nxn复数矩阵,g是nx1列向量

如果我想最大化这个,在cvx中,最大化凸函数是不允许的


如何将其转换为凹面等效形式?

这通常是不可能的。有时一阶条件(或KKT条件,如果有约束)会导致更容易解决的问题。@ErwinKalvelagen I实际上使用了一阶近似来解决它。